“Abi Mott’s business model is simple. Abi is from Lancaster originally but now lives in Denver, CO. After high school she met a man in San Francisco who typed poems for people on the street, and then she took up the craft herself. She’s traveled across the country and set up a small table, a typewriter and a sign with her simple business model printed in big letters”… (full story and photos)
